    Yeah but there are things that end up being impressive and stay that way. A server second isn't impressive because someone already beat you to it. World first kills aren't even impressive anymore because theres barely no gap between when others kill it as well. Basically a world first is whatever guild can gather 25 people and make it to the encounter and give it a few attempts.

    There are things that remain impressive but there is likely a huge gimmick attached to them. Herald of the Titans is one of my favorite ideas. The Immortal title from Naxx, even by todays gear standards...its impressive when a raid of 25 people...you dont have 1 idiot who managed to stand still on Heigans fight. Even more impressive is the no dying achievement for Ulduar...I have yet to come accross anyone with the title.
